Defend your tree against the invading insects by hurling leaves at them! How many can you defend? A classic top-down shooter in the style of "Space Invaders", this game features destructible shields and multiple enemy types.
Supercar Parking Simulator
Cut For Cat Game
Baby Panda Boy Caring
Cowboy Runner
Magic Match
G2M Island Escape
space shooter VS aliens and asterods
Winter White Outfits: Dress Up Game
Darts Pro Multiplayer
Halloween Moster Vs Zombies
City Construction Simulator Master 3D
Adventure Time
Peckish Kappa
Merge Food Puzzle
Royal Helix Jump 3D
Fashion Girl Dressup
DragonBall Match Cards
Pop It Crabs Jigsaw
Panda Cleanup Master
Peacock Jigsaw
Pou Caring For Kid
Puzzles - So Different Princess
Red Crab Draw
Steve and Alex Dragon Egg
Amgel Kids Room Escape 58
Cleaner
Gullo 3
Gss Prado
Thats Not My Neighbor 2
Tuu Bot 2